Haven't dealt with JDBC connections however I capture ODBC traffic all the time, unless you turn on encryption the sql 
traffic is in plain text so normally I just find a query I'm looking for (wireshark find command, find String in Packet 
bytes), follow that stream and it's all there in readable format, requests and responses.
